87.28 percent of the population in 90278 drive to work alone. 1.11 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 62.01 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 13.32 percent of the residents in 90278 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 2.55 members with about 2.08 cars available per household.
An estimate of 96.28 percent of the residents in 90278 has some form of health insurance. 19.86 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 84.18 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 90278 would have to travel an average of 4.93 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Memorial Hospital Of Gardena .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 90278, Redondo Beach, California.

As of , an estimate of 42,841 residents live in 90278 with a median age of 38.1 years. 24.77 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 12.06 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 41.19 percent of the residents in 90278 is currently married, and 21.65 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 90278 is $13,797.08.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 90278 is approximately $2,529. The median household spends about 18.33 percent of their income on housing.

Locals with Prostate Cancer typically access healthcare through various medical facilities and specialists located within or near 90278. Notable healthcare providers in the area include Providence Little Company of Mary Medical Center Torrance and Torrance Memorial Medical Center. These facilities offer comprehensive cancer care programs that cater to individuals with Prostate Cancer, providing access to specialized treatments and support services.
